Proper name [Portuguese]

IPA: /kõs.tɐ̃.t͡ʃiˈnɔ.plɐ/ [Brazil], /kõs.tɐ̃.t͡ʃiˈnɔ.plɐ/ [Brazil], /kõʃ.tɐ̃.t͡ʃiˈnɔ.plɐ/ [Rio-de-Janeiro], /kõs.tɐ̃.t͡ʃiˈnɔ.pla/ [Southern-Brazil], /kõʃ.tɐ̃.tiˈnɔ.plɐ/ [Portugal]
Etymology: Borrowed from Ancient Greek Κωνσταντινούπολις (Kōnstantinoúpolis, “Constantine’s city”), with change of declension. (historical) Constantinople (The former name, from 330–1930 C.E., of Istanbul, the largest city in Turkey; the former capital of the Ottoman Empire and of the Byzantine Empire before that; modern Istambul) Tags: feminine, historical Categories (place): Cities in Turkey, Places in Turkey Related terms: Constantino, pólis

Proper name [Spanish]

IPA: /konstantiˈnopla/, [kõns.t̪ãn̪.t̪iˈno.pla]
